Court OKs Request for Single Milosevic Trial

Share
From Times Wire Reports

Former Yugoslav President Slobodan Milosevic will face only one trial to answer for three separate indictments for war crimes in Kosovo, Croatia and Bosnia-Herzegovina, the U.N. tribunal said.

An appellate bench of the tribunal in The Hague agreed to a prosecution request to hold a single trial for Milosevic, allowing key witnesses to appear only once rather than be recalled for several trials.

The court said the trial could begin as scheduled Feb. 12.

Prosecutors have said they will call as many as 30 political insiders to testify and link Milosevic to the atrocities during his 13-year rule.
